Profile
Mr. Schoepke joined Optimum in 2009.
He has several years of industry experience, including managing client portfolios at JPMorgan, LaSalle Bank Wealth Management Group and the Harris Private Bank.
He is a Certified Financial Planner, a Chartered Trust & Financial Advisor, level II candidate for the CFA designation and holds NASD licenses 7 and 66.
He is a member of the CFA Chicago Investment Society and the Institute for Certified Bankers.
Mr. Schoepke received a BA in Finance from Northern Illinois University in 1988.
